Your role and responsibilities

As a Hardware Developer: Generalist, you will use design documentation to develop IBM hardware and technology products, ensuring components are unit tested and ready for integration. You will work on delivering quality systems to meet market needs, establishing relationships across IBM and with external suppliers/vendors.

Your primary responsibilities will include:

Develop Hardware Products: Use design documentation, such as Functional Specifications and high-level design documents, to develop server systems, storage systems, and networking systems, ensuring components are unit tested and ready for integration.

Provide Fixes: Deliver fixes to defects identified by the verification team during the development life cycle, ensuring quality systems meet market needs.

Test and Validate: Test the functional and RAS aspects of the implementation, supporting customer environments in providing end-to-end solutions and resolution of issues.

Collaborate with Suppliers: Establish relationships across IBM and with external suppliers/vendors to support the development of quality systems.

Support Customer Environments: Provide support for customer environments, delivering end-to-end solutions and resolving issues.
